Output 313c233a8d220f3486da45e04842d971f9505268c3236b0de3c566b1d793f43c:1

value
183600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b1e42dec8643f592de2502d684d54e26ff6c36 OP_EQUAL
address
3NdXmaXjrRPG4X1TSZKyUha4o2p5dEoWkv
transaction
313c233a8d220f3486da45e04842d971f9505268c3236b0de3c566b1d793f43c
confirmations
343613
spent
true